Crash Closes Interstate; Sends Six To The Hospital

A nightmare Friday afternoon for people traveling for the Memorial Day holiday weekend. A serious crash closed Interstate 75 down just as people were hitting the road for vacation.

The crash involved two cars near the 106 mile marker in the northbound lanes in Fayette County. Five people were taken to the hospital in ambulances. A sixth victim had to be airlifted from the scene.

Police, EMS workers and firefighters were helped at the scene by National Guard troops who happened to be driving past the scene.

All northbound lanes were closed for a time while crews worked to clear the scene. The whole road re-opened by 5:00 Friday afternoon.

There's no word yet on the identities of the victims or their conditions.
